RFP: TRADITIONAL FOOD KNOWLEDGE PROJECT

The Mohawk Council of Akwesasne is seeking proposals for a qualified consultant to conduct interviews of community elders on traditional practices for successfully growing a family garden. Additionally, the consultant will also interview community elders who have experience with hunting and fishing within the community on the historical importance of hunting and fishing. POLICE INVESTIGATE SUDDEN DEATH IN TSI SNAIHNE

On the evening of September 7, 2021, Akwesasne Central Dispatch received a call of an unresponsive male at a residence in Tsi Snaihne (Snye), QC.   The Akwesasne Mohawk Police Service and the Akwesasne Mohawk Ambulance Unit attended the residence and provided life-saving measures to a male who was transported to a hospital and later pronounced deceased.
